WebJul 19, 2009 · The Hebrew “raqam” (“woven together” in NIV; “curiously wrought” in KJV) refers to “embroidery”, the intricate interweaving or stitching of various colored fabrics to produce a representation or picture upon the fabric.The same word occurs seven times in Exodus (27:16; 28:39; 35:35; 36:37; 38:18, 23; 39:29), where it describes the …
